Biography

Mukherjee was born in Kolkata. He lost his father in an early age. He was admitted in Sarsuna High School from where he passed Madhyamik examination. He passed Higher Secondary Examination from New Alipore Multipurpose High School. He graduated from the Asutosh College, a University of Calcutta affiliate.[2]

Mukherjee is mainly knowns as a stage actor. Ramaprasad Banik and Chandan Sen taught him acting.[2]He is currently the General Secretary of "West Bengal Motion Picture Artists' Forum"[3] since 2022. His son is Rwitobroto Mukherjee who is also an actor, working primarily in films, web series and stage.

Radio

  • In 2022, Radio Mirchi Kolkata aired Sunil Gangopadhyay's Kakababu adventure story Bhoyonkor Sundor. The character of Kakababu was voiced by Mukherjee while RJ Agni voiced the character of Santu.
